### 1/5 — It’s like Tinder… For Care

*2026-08-17*

As a recipient, I find this service very frustrating. Yes, it works for people needing a babysitter or senior care, or tutors. But m fall into a category that they don’t even have. I am a person with a spinal cord injury. That takes a very different kind of care than the other categories offer. But the problem is that all of these caregivers don’t understand that and 95% of them don’t even read the profile. I have a caregiver that is in the service and she showed me the interface. It’s exactly like Tinder. You swipe to see somebody and you don’t need to look at anything, but hit the button to say that you’re interested. They don’t look at the hours, they don’t look at the description, they don’t look at the requirements so, I get a lot of people that are in their 60s and 70s thinking that they can lift a 160 pound male. I get a lot of people that want an 8 to 5 job but I need someone here early in the morning and someone late at night. 70% of the time they don’t respond after first saying they’re interested. I have to list my profile in the  senior care or adult care or special needs. None of those really take into account my needs. If someone saw that there was a spinal cord injury category, then they would understand what kind of care might be involved. This app is like gambling because I keep hoping that one of the people that is interested in my job will fit my qualifications. But it never happens.

### 1/5 — Care.com Is No Longer Effectively Matching Families and Caregivers

*2026-08-11, version 24.58*

I have used Care.com successfully for many years and historically considered it the best resource for finding professional childcare positions. Unfortunately, my experience with the platform today is dramatically different.

I have 20+ years of professional childcare experience, two relevant bachelor’s degrees, and extensive experience as a nanny, early childhood educator and household manager. In the past, I could apply to 20–30 appropriate positions, hear back from a significant percentage of families, and generally find a great position quickly. During my current search, I have applied to 100+ positions over several months and received responses from only a handful.

The problem appears to affect families too. A family I recently interviewed with told me they received approximately 50 applicants, many of whom did not meet the qualifications they were seeking. They wanted specific professional experience and relevant education, yet ultimately had to use ChatGPT to help sort their Care.com applicants because the platform did not give them adequate tools to efficiently identify candidates matching those criteria.

Meanwhile, caregivers are now being offered $2.99 paid “Boosts” for individual applications. For someone conducting a serious job search, boosting 100 applications would cost nearly $300 on top of other membership costs. Care should also clearly explain how Premium and Boosts affect where applications actually appear.

Care.com needs better qualification-based matching, stronger filtering and sorting tools for families, and greater transparency about how applications are ranked. Families shouldn’t have to sift manually through dozens of poorly matched candidates, and qualified caregivers shouldn’t feel they need to pay per application simply to be seen.

I genuinely want Care.com to improve because it was an excellent resource for me for many years. The current system seems to be making it harder for both sides of the marketplace to find one another.
